Output 24a732ddfde5296c3758beff70d8b7ee1ba9d85f7a7878de5b734fb045bdc0aa:2

value
105466690
script pubkey
OP_0 OP_PUSHBYTES_20 904d7b2c94a1b4f5bd18e3cf79b35659f8e0debd
address
ltc1qjpxhkty55x60t0gcu08hnv6kt8uwph4a2x4223
transaction
24a732ddfde5296c3758beff70d8b7ee1ba9d85f7a7878de5b734fb045bdc0aa
spent
true